Inuwa Wins New Telegraph Governor of the Year 2023

Gombe State governor, Muhammadu Inuwa Yahaya, has been nominated by the New Telegraph Newspaper for the award of Governor of the Year 2023 on Education.
In a letter signed by the newspaper’s managing director/editor-in-chief, Ayodele Aminu, and addressed to the governor, the media house said Governor Yahaya’s giant strides in education couple with his determination to chart a new course in public service, built on integrity, transparency and the strong desire to improve the livelihoods of the people, informed his choice for the award.

“As Governor of Gombe State, you have improved the state’s rating in nearly all indices of human development and standard of living. It is on record that under your watch, Gombe State has witnessed giant strides in Education. Since your foray into politics, you have left no one in doubt of your determination to chart a new course in public service, built on integrity, transparency and the strong desire to improve the livelihoods of the people,” Aminu said.

The organisation particularly noted the following achievements of the governor in the education sector: construction and renovation of over 1,440 classrooms across the state; mopping up of over 350,000 out-of-school children; upgrade of five secondary schools to mega-school standards and construction of four special schools (to take care of special needs); recruitment of 1,000 teachers and strengthening of vocational and technical education through various partnerships like the Innovation in Development and Effectiveness in

Acquisition of Skills (IDEAS), which is a World Bank-assisted project.
According to Aminu, these and many other efforts, led to a number of positive outcomes in the education sector, including a sharp increase in the percentage of candidates in public schools who passed WASSCE with 5 credits or above including Mathematics and English from 28 percent in 2019 to 73 percent in 2021 and 78 percent in 2022, noting that the governor’s performance had become a reference point to his contemporaries across the North East region and Nigeria at large.
The governor will be presented with the prestigious New Telegraph award at a ceremony slated for Friday, February 2, 2024, at Balmoral Hall, Federal Palace Hotels, Victoria Island, Lagos.
